Top LGBTQ+ Wellness Groups to Join for Community and Support

Finding a supportive community is crucial for the well-being of LGBTQ+ individuals. These support groups offer safe spaces where members can share experiences, seek advice, and forge lasting friendships. One notable group to consider is PFLAG, which provides invaluable resources, advocacy, and a network for LGBTQ+ people and their families. Likewise, The Trevor Project offers crisis intervention and suicide prevention services tailored specifically for LGBTQ+ youth. These organizations emphasize the importance of community connections and understanding, ensuring that no one feels alone in their journey.

Another excellent group to explore is queer support group called GLAAD. This organization focuses on combating negative stereotypes, encouraging advocacy, and promoting equality through various media channels. They host community events that unite individuals under shared goals of acceptance and Pride. Additionally, OutRight Action International promotes human rights and advocates for LGBTQ+ over the globe. By joining such groups, individuals not only receive support but also contribute to a broader movement toward societal acceptance. Local LGBTQ+ centers often provide various peer-led support groups, offering comfort and resources in a group setting.

Local LGBTQ+ Wellness Resources

In many cities, local LGBTQ+ centers serve as invaluable hubs for support and community engagement. They often host events showcasing local LGBTQ+ artists, creating welcoming spaces that foster connections. For instance, the Human Rights Campaign provides educational materials and links to local resources. Online forums are also accessible for those who may find it easier to connect digitally. Websites such as Reddit have numerous LGBTQ+ topics for open discussion, where individuals can provide real-time support and share valuable insights without judgment.

Furthermore, social media platforms can serve as an extension of these communities. Joining groups on Facebook or Instagram provides quick access to shared experiences, news updates, and upcoming events in the LGBTQ+ community. Engaging in conversations and asking questions can lead to discovering local groups and resources. Community-building is not limited to in-person interactions. Online meetups and webinars arranged through platforms such as Zoom can reinforce connections among participants, creating supportive networks regardless of geographical barriers.

Volunteer Opportunities

Participating in volunteer opportunities within LGBTQ+ organizations solidifies community connections while providing support to marginalized groups. Volunteering fosters personal growth and creates valuable connections with other individuals passionate about equality and acceptance. Groups like Lambda Legal focus on providing legal support to those facing discrimination or unjust practices. Their volunteer programs not only enhance legal awareness but also encourage community service, helping those in need while fostering support among members.
